Series Co-creator and Director Erin Lee Carr joins journalist Mandy Matney to discuss how victims’ voices are elevated in the series presenting their lives, not just tragic deaths. This conversation on justice, identity, and resilience shows why this series ascends beyond just entertainment.

Matney and Carr dive into the series’ careful use of empathy, the importance of representation, and how art can help heal grief while demanding accountability.  Co-host Liz Farrell contributes perspective on the journalistic and ethical weight of covering Stephen’s case — emphasizing compassion for victims, frustration with systemic neglect, and the need for emotional truth-telling through both media and art.

We also hear from Stephen Smith’s mother Sandy, who shares what it meant to see her son portrayed with love and dignity on screen—and her ongoing hope that renewed attention will finally bring truth to light about her son’s unsolved homicide.
